It is a lot of fun. Doug W7DVR To ALL: Well it is almost that time again. The 2008 Idaho QSO Party is almost here. This will be the 3rd year now since I have been trying to get Idaho on the map. And so far it keeps getting bigger with more participants. But it will not continue to grow unless we here in Idaho get involved. So I am hoping everyone will put in at least a few hours of operating time so that this event will get even better. With input from several of you I have changed the rules to make it one 24 hour event. It runs from noon Saturday to noon Sunday Mountain time. I am hoping that will make it more appealing for those who would like to do so. Again it is supposed to be a fun event. You can do any mode, digital, cw, phone, HF, VHF, High/low/qrp power. What ever you chose. Just make it fun for you and help put Idaho on the map. I ask that you spread the word to as many as you can throughout your clubs and friends. And if you have any questions fell free to email me. I have a new call as I have made Idaho my home and now it is NX7TT.. But the web page is still WWW.NT4TT.COM to find the rules.
